What Are Non-Prescription Drugs?
Non-prescription drugs are medications that can be acquired without a physician's prescription. They are generally considered safe and reliable for self-treatment of moderate to moderate health issues. The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) classifies these drugs as safe for public use when consumed according to the advised dose and standards.

While non-prescription drugs are widely utilized, it is essential for customers to use them properly. Here are some key security factors to consider:

Read Labels Carefully: OTC medications include particular dose directions and warnings. Always abide by the advised dosages and be aware of prospective negative effects.

Seek advice from a Healthcare Provider: Although lots of non-prescription drugs are safe, individuals with pre-existing medical conditions or those taking other medications should speak with health care professionals before beginning any new medication.

Expect Allergic Reactions: Some individuals may experience allergies to certain non-prescription drugs. It is essential to cease usage and seek medical attention if signs like rashes, difficulty breathing, or swelling happen.

Understand Drug Interactions: Certain OTC medications can interact with prescription drugs, decreasing their effectiveness or increasing the threat of adverse effects. Always reveal all medications you are taking to your healthcare provider.

Monitor Symptoms: If symptoms persist or get worse after taking non-prescription medications, speak with a health care specialist. These medications are implied for momentary relief and needs to not be seen as replacement for medical diagnosis and treatment.

What is the distinction between prescription and non-prescription drugs?
Prescription drugs need a medical professional's approval to acquire, whereas non-prescription drugs can be acquired directly by consumers without a prescription. Prescription drugs typically treat more severe medical conditions and might come with more considerable capacity negative effects.
2. Are non-prescription drugs totally safe?
While non-prescription drugs are normally considered safe for usage, they can still posture dangers, specifically if used improperly. It's crucial to read labels, comply with dosage standards, and seek advice from doctor for tailored advice.
3. Can non-prescription drugs connect with other medications?
Yes, non-prescription drugs can engage with prescription medications and other OTC Prescription-Free Drugs. Constantly reveal all medications you're requiring to your health care supplier to avoid prospective interactions.
4. How should non-prescription medications be stored?
Non-prescription medications need to be kept in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and moisture. Keep them out of reach of kids and follow the storage guidelines offered on the label.
5. What should I do if I miss out on a dosage?
For the majority of non-prescription medications, if you miss out on a dose, take it as quickly as you remember. Nevertheless, if it's almost time for your next dosage, skip the missed out on dosage and resume your regular schedule. Do not double the dosage to catch up.
